TikTok’s Wildest Fast Food Hacks—Tested and Rated

TikTok is where creativity meets cravings. From upside-down burger flips to bizarre menu mashups, the app has become a viral playground for fast food hacks. But not everything that trends actually works. We put some of the most popular TikTok fast food tricks to the test—here’s what was worth the hype, what flopped, and what you should try next time you’re in line.

  1. McDonald’s Hash Brown McMuffin Hack
    The Hack: Insert a hash brown inside your Sausage McMuffin for added crunch.
    Result: Surprisingly great texture. The crispiness adds a savory boost without overpowering the sandwich.
    Rating: 9/10

  2. Chipotle Quesadilla + Fajita Veggies + Vinaigrette Dip
    The Hack: Order a steak quesadilla with fajita veggies and a side of Chipotle’s honey vinaigrette to dip.
    Result: A sweet-savory combo that’s far better than expected. The vinaigrette adds tangy depth to the rich filling.
    Rating: 10/10

  3. Starbucks Iced White Mocha with Sweet Cream Foam and Caramel Drizzle
    The Hack: Custom order via the Starbucks app for an ultra-sweet, Instagram-worthy drink.
    Result: Delicious but heavy on sugar—ideal for dessert, not your daily coffee.
    Rating: 8/10
  4. Taco Bell “Incredible Hulk” Burrito
    The Hack: Ask for a 5-Layer Burrito with guac instead of nacho cheese and no inner tortilla.
    Result: Fresh and flavorful. Skipping cheese lightens it up while the guac adds richness.
    Rating: 8/10

  5. Wendy’s Fries Dipped in Frosty
    The Hack: Dip hot, salty fries into a cold Frosty for a sweet-salty contrast.
    Result: Classic. If you haven’t tried this, you’re missing out.
    Rating: 10/10

  6. Chick-fil-A Mac & Cheese + Nuggets = Mac Bowl
    The Hack: Combine mac & cheese with nuggets and sauces to create a custom bowl.
    Result: Comfort food central. Even better when using Spicy Nuggets.
    Rating: 9/10

  7. Burger King Rodeo Burger DIY
    The Hack: Order a cheeseburger and add onion rings and BBQ sauce from the value menu.
    Result: A budget-friendly twist that tastes like a premium sandwich.
    Rating: 7/10

  8. Panera “Hack Menu” Green Smoothie Mix
    The Hack: Mix the Green Passion Smoothie with the Strawberry Banana Smoothie for a fruit-forward blend.
    Result: Refreshing and balanced—not overly sweet, and easy to make in-store.
    Rating: 8/10
  9. Dunkin’ Iced Coffee with Vanilla and Hazelnut Swirls + Sweet Cold Foam
    The Hack: A layered iced coffee combo from TikTokers that mimics a Nutella-inspired flavor.
    Result: Unique, nutty, and worth trying if you like bold flavors.
    Rating: 8/10

  10. Popeyes Chicken Tenders + Mashed Potatoes Bowl
    The Hack: Build your own KFC Famous Bowl-style meal by combining tenders, mashed potatoes, and gravy.
    Result: Hearty and delicious. Adds variety to the typical Popeyes order.
    Rating: 9/10
